SeasonBite

  • Recipes
    • Easy Dinners
    • One-Pot Meals
    • Seafood
  • Contact
  • About
menu icon
go to homepage
  • Recipes
    • Easy Dinners
    • One-Pot Meals
    • Seafood
  • Contact
  • About
search icon
Homepage link
  • Recipes
    • Easy Dinners
    • One-Pot Meals
    • Seafood
  • Contact
  • About
×

Deliciously Golden Spinach Puffs That Wow Your Taste Buds

Published: Dec 15, 2025 by Sierra Lane · This post may contain affiliate links · Leave a Comment

Jump to Recipe Print Recipe

As I rummaged through my fridge one afternoon, a colorful bounty of fresh spinach caught my eye, sparking an idea for a delightful treat: Spinach Puffs! These little morsels are a fantastic twist on traditional pastries, offering a splendid mix of creamy ricotta and tangy feta that’s bound to impress. What I love most about this recipe is how quickly they come together—perfect for a last-minute gathering or even a cozy night in. Plus, they freeze beautifully, making them a handy snack option for those busy weeknights when homemade just feels right. With golden, flaky layers surrounding a savory filling, these Spinach Puffs are sure to win over the hearts and taste buds of everyone at your table. What’s your favorite filling for savory pastries?

Spinach Puffs

What makes Spinach Puffs irresistible?

Simplicity: This recipe is a breeze to whip up, even for beginner cooks—perfect for a quick snack or appetizer!
Flavor Explosion: The rich combination of creamy ricotta and tangy feta, paired with the perfect hint of nutmeg, makes every bite unforgettable.
Crowd Pleaser: With approximately 20 servings, these puffs are ideal for parties or family meals, ensuring everyone leaves satisfied.
Freezer-Friendly: Make a big batch, freeze them, and enjoy homemade goodness whenever cravings strike.
Versatile Filling: Feel free to get creative—substitute veggies or cheeses to customize your delicious puffs!
These golden delights truly elevate any gathering, leaving your guests asking for the recipe. Try serving them with your favorite dipping sauces for an added treat!

Spinach Puffs Ingredients

Unlock the deliciousness of homemade Spinach Puffs with these easy-to-find ingredients!

For the Filling

  • Olive oil – adds a rich flavor; consider using garlic-infused oil for a twist.
  • Medium onion – brings sweetness; yellow or red onions work beautifully.
  • Garlic cloves – fresh is best; feel free to adjust based on your preference.
  • Spinach – chopped (fresh or thawed frozen) – packed with nutrients and flavor!
  • Ricotta cheese – creamy texture that melds perfectly with the filling.
  • Feta cheese – adds a tangy kick; crumbled goat cheese can be a great substitute.
  • Salt – enhances all the flavors; use sea salt for a gourmet touch.
  • Black pepper – for a mild heat; fresh cracked pepper intensifies the taste.
  • Nutmeg – a pinch elevates the filling; it pairs beautifully with spinach.

For the Pastry

  • Puff pastry – thawed and ready to embrace that savory filling; store-bought saves time!

For the Egg Wash

  • Egg – helps achieve that golden-brown finish; for a vegan option, substitute with almond milk.

Gather these ingredients to create scrumptious Spinach Puffs that will have your family and friends raving!

Step‑by‑Step Instructions for Spinach Puffs

Step 1: Sauté the Aromatics
In a large skillet, heat 1 tablespoon of olive oil over medium heat until shimmering. Add 1 chopped medium onion and sauté for about 5 minutes, or until it becomes translucent. Stir in 2 minced garlic cloves and cook for an additional 30 seconds until fragrant, filling your kitchen with an inviting aroma.

Step 2: Cook the Spinach
Add 1 cup of chopped spinach to the skillet and cook until wilted, about 2-3 minutes, stirring frequently. Make sure to let any excess moisture evaporate, which helps prevent soggy Spinach Puffs. Once wilted, remove the mixture from heat and allow it to cool slightly while you prepare the filling.

Step 3: Mix the Filling
In a mixing bowl, combine the cooled spinach mixture with 1 cup of ricotta cheese, 1 cup of crumbled feta cheese, 1 teaspoon of salt, ½ teaspoon of black pepper, and 1 teaspoon of nutmeg. Use a spatula to mix everything together until the filling is cohesive and creamy, ensuring the flavors are well distributed throughout.

Step 4: Prepare the Pastry
Preheat your oven to 400°F (200°C) and line a baking sheet with parchment paper. Roll out the thawed puff pastry on a lightly floured surface, smoothing it out gently with a rolling pin. Cut the pastry into approximately 3-inch squares or circles, ensuring they are uniform for even baking.

Step 5: Fill the Pastry
Place a generous spoonful of the spinach filling in the center of each pastry piece. Carefully fold the pastry over to create a triangle shape, or fold circles in half. Seal the edges by pressing down firmly with a fork, ensuring each Spinach Puff is securely closed to trap in the delicious filling.

Step 6: Egg Wash for Shine
In a small bowl, beat 1 egg and use a pastry brush to gently brush the tops of each filled pastry. This egg wash will create a beautiful golden color when baked. Make sure to evenly coat the tops for that perfect, shiny finish that is visually appealing.

Step 7: Bake the Puffs
Arrange the prepared Spinach Puffs on the baking sheet, ensuring there's space between each for even heat circulation. Bake in the preheated oven for 15-20 minutes, or until they are puffed and golden brown. Keep an eye on them towards the end to prevent over-baking and ensure a crispy texture.

Step 8: Cool and Serve
Once golden brown, remove the Spinach Puffs from the oven and let them cool slightly on a wire rack. This brief cooling period allows the filling to set a bit more. Serve warm, and enjoy them fresh from the oven as a delightful appetizer or snack that everyone will love!

Spinach Puffs

How to Store and Freeze Spinach Puffs

Room Temperature: Spinach Puffs can be kept at room temperature for about 2 hours if they are not filled or topped with sauces.

Fridge: Store leftover Spinach Puffs in an airtight container in the refrigerator for up to 3 days. Reheat them in an oven for the best texture.

Freezer: To freeze, place the filled and unbaked Spinach Puffs on a baking sheet until solid, then transfer them to a freezer bag. They can be frozen for up to 2 months.

Reheating: Bake frozen Spinach Puffs directly from the freezer at 400°F (200°C) for about 20-25 minutes, until they're heated through and golden brown again.

Make Ahead Options

These Spinach Puffs are perfect for meal prep enthusiasts looking to save time on busy weeknights! You can prepare the filling (spinach, ricotta, feta, and seasonings) up to 3 days in advance and store it in the refrigerator until you're ready to assemble. Additionally, you can assemble the Spinach Puffs and freeze them unbaked for up to 1 month. Just be sure to arrange them on a baking sheet and freeze until solid before transferring them to a freezer bag to maintain their shape and quality. When you're ready to bake, there’s no need to thaw—simply brush with egg wash and bake directly from the freezer, adding a couple of extra minutes to the baking time for delicious, freshly baked puffs!

What to Serve with Spinach Puffs?

Elevate your dining experience with delightful pairings that complement these luscious bites!

  • Creamy Tomato Soup: The smooth, rich flavors of tomato soup contrast beautifully with the flaky pastry, creating a comforting duo that warms the soul.
  • Mixed Green Salad: A fresh salad, tossed with a zesty vinaigrette, adds a crisp, refreshing element, balancing the scrumptious richness of the Spinach Puffs.
  • Garlic Herb Dip: This dip's creamy garlic flavor perfectly enhances the savory filling, giving a delightful contrast and making each bite even more enjoyable.
  • Roasted Vegetables: Caramelized veggies bring a sweet, earthy note to the table, offering a satisfying crunch that pairs well with the soft interior of the puffs.
  • Hummus Platter: Serve with an assortment of hummus flavors for a Mediterranean twist, adding depth and variety to your appetizer spread.
  • Chilled White Wine: A glass of crisp Sauvignon Blanc or a light Pinot Grigio complements the savory filling and flaky pastry, enhancing the overall dining experience.
  • Chocolate Dipped Strawberries: Finish your meal with this unexpected sweet touch; the fresh strawberries and rich chocolate provide a perfect contrast to the savory puffs.

These pairings will undoubtedly elevate your gathering, creating a memorable and delightful dining experience!

Spinach Puffs Variations & Substitutions

Feel free to play around with this recipe to create your perfect Spinach Puffs!

  • Dairy-Free: Substitute ricotta and feta with almond or cashew cheese, providing a creamy texture without the dairy.
    Opt for a plant-based cheese that complements the savory filling while maintaining that delightful creaminess.

  • Gluten-Free: Swap the puff pastry for gluten-free dough or store-bought gluten-free pastry sheets.
    Your Spinach Puffs can still be flaky and delicious, catering to those with gluten sensitivities without sacrificing flavor.

  • Spicy Twist: Add a pinch of cayenne pepper or crushed red pepper flakes to the filling for a little heat.
    This addition will bring an exciting kick, making these puffs a hit for those who love a bit of spice in their snacks.

  • Herb-Infused: Include fresh herbs like dill or basil into the filling for an aromatic lift.
    These herbs will not only enhance flavor but also add vibrant layers of freshness that will captivate your senses.

  • Meaty Addition: Mix in cooked crumbled sausage or bacon for a heartier puff.
    This twist will create a robust flavor profile, making the puffs even more satisfying and perfect for meat lovers.

  • Different Greens: Swap spinach with chopped kale, Swiss chard, or even arugula for varied tastes.
    With every leafy green, you’ll discover a unique flavor experience, keeping your puffs exciting and fresh every time.

  • Change the Cheese: Try using goat cheese or a blend of mozzarella and parmesan for different textures and flavors.
    Each cheese brings its character, allowing you to tailor the puffs to suit your palate perfectly.

  • Savory and Sweet: Add finely chopped sundried tomatoes or olives for a Mediterranean tab and an unexpected twist.
    These ingredients can elevate your Spinach Puffs into something unique and delightful, making every bite memorable.

These variations encourage you to get creative in the kitchen, turning simple ingredients into extraordinary treats! If you want to explore even more ideas, check out these amazing ways to elevate your culinary creations. Happy cooking!

Expert Tips for Spinach Puffs

  • Avoid Sogginess: Make sure to cook the spinach until all excess moisture evaporates to keep your Spinach Puffs crispy.
  • Sealing the Edges: Press down firmly with a fork to ensure the edges are well sealed; this prevents any filling from leaking out during baking.
  • Egg Wash for Color: Don’t skip the egg wash! It provides a beautiful golden sheen that makes your Spinach Puffs visually appealing and more appetizing.
  • Custom Fillings: Feel free to swap out the cheeses or add different vegetables for personal twists; just make sure they are well-drained to maintain texture.
  • Freezing Tips: Prepare a big batch and freeze them raw on a baking sheet. Once frozen, transfer them to a bag; bake straight from frozen, adding a few extra minutes to the cook time.

Spinach Puffs

Spinach Puffs Recipe FAQs

What type of spinach should I use?
You can use fresh or thawed frozen spinach for your Spinach Puffs. If using fresh, ensure it's vibrant green and not wilted or yellowed. Frozen spinach should be thoroughly thawed and drained well to avoid excess moisture in your filling.

How should I store leftover Spinach Puffs?
Store any leftover Spinach Puffs in an airtight container in the refrigerator for up to 3 days. Reheat in the oven at 350°F (175°C) for about 10-15 minutes for the best texture—this will keep them crispy on the outside.

Can Spinach Puffs be frozen?
Absolutely! To freeze them, place the filled and unbaked Spinach Puffs on a baking sheet lined with parchment paper. Once frozen solid, transfer them to a freezer bag. They'll stay fresh for up to 3 months!

How do I reheat frozen Spinach Puffs?
You can bake frozen Spinach Puffs directly from the freezer. Preheat your oven to 400°F (200°C), arrange the puffs on a baking sheet, and bake for about 20-25 minutes, or until they are puffed and golden brown.

What if my Spinach Puffs are soggy?
To avoid sogginess, ensure that you cook the spinach until all excess moisture has evaporated. After cooking, let the mixture cool a little before filling your pastry to prevent steam, which can make the pastry wet.

Are these Spinach Puffs suitable for those with dietary allergies?
If you're preparing for someone with dietary restrictions, consider substituting ingredients! For example, use dairy-free cheese to accommodate lactose intolerance. Always double-check your ingredients for potential allergens.

Spinach Puffs

Deliciously Golden Spinach Puffs That Wow Your Taste Buds

These Spinach Puffs are a delightful mix of creamy ricotta and tangy feta wrapped in flaky pastry, perfect for any gathering.
Print Recipe Pin Recipe
Prep Time 15 minutes mins
Cook Time 20 minutes mins
Total Time 35 minutes mins
Course Appetizers
Cuisine American
Servings 20 puffs
Calories 150 kcal

Equipment

  • skillet
  • mixing bowl
  • baking sheet
  • Pastry Brush

Ingredients
  

For the Filling

  • 1 tablespoon Olive oil consider using garlic-infused oil for a twist
  • 1 medium Onion chopped; yellow or red onions work beautifully
  • 2 cloves Garlic minced; fresh is best
  • 1 cup Spinach chopped (fresh or thawed frozen)
  • 1 cup Ricotta cheese creamy texture
  • 1 cup Feta cheese crumbled; crumbled goat cheese can be a great substitute
  • 1 teaspoon Salt sea salt for a gourmet touch
  • ½ teaspoon Black pepper fresh cracked is best
  • 1 teaspoon Nutmeg a pinch elevates the flavor

For the Pastry

  • 1 package Puff pastry thawed

For the Egg Wash

  • 1 large Egg or substitute with almond milk for a vegan option

Instructions
 

Step-by-Step Instructions for Spinach Puffs

  • Sauté the Aromatics: In a large skillet, heat olive oil over medium heat and sauté onion for about 5 minutes until translucent. Stir in garlic and cook for 30 seconds until fragrant.
  • Cook the Spinach: Add spinach and cook until wilted, about 2-3 minutes. Remove from heat and cool slightly.
  • Mix the Filling: In a bowl, combine the cooled spinach mixture with ricotta, feta, salt, black pepper, and nutmeg. Mix until creamy.
  • Prepare the Pastry: Preheat oven to 400°F (200°C). Roll out puff pastry and cut into 3-inch squares or circles.
  • Fill the Pastry: Place a spoonful of spinach filling in the center of each pastry. Fold and seal edges with a fork.
  • Egg Wash for Shine: Beat the egg and brush the tops of each filled pastry to ensure a golden finish.
  • Bake the Puffs: Arrange on a baking sheet and bake for 15-20 minutes until golden brown.
  • Cool and Serve: Let cool slightly before serving warm.

Notes

These Spinach Puffs can be frozen before baking for up to 2 months. Bake from frozen, adding a few extra minutes of cooking time.

Nutrition

Serving: 1puffCalories: 150kcalCarbohydrates: 12gProtein: 5gFat: 10gSaturated Fat: 4gPolyunsaturated Fat: 1gMonounsaturated Fat: 4gCholesterol: 50mgSodium: 300mgPotassium: 120mgFiber: 1gSugar: 1gVitamin A: 1500IUVitamin C: 15mgCalcium: 150mgIron: 2mg
Keyword cheese-filled, easy appetizers, freezer-friendly, party snacks, savory pastries, Spinach Puffs
Tried this recipe?Let us know how it was!

More Appetizers

  • Cheesy Pepperoni Pizza Bombs
    Irresistibly Cheesy Pepperoni Pizza Bombs for Easy Snacking
  • Bacon Brie Crescent Wreath
    Bacon Brie Crescent Wreath: A Cheesy, Holiday Delight!
  • Savory Mushroom & Gruyère Puff Pastry Braid
    Indulge in Savory Mushroom & Gruyère Puff Pastry Braid Delight
  • Cranberry Brie Crescent Ring
    Cranberry Brie Crescent Ring: A Festive, Cheesy Treat

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

Recipe Rating




About Sierra Lane

Season-obsessed cook sharing quick, produce-packed recipes for everyday meals—straight from my farmers’ market basket to your table.

Sierra’s Story

Popular

  • Butter Pecan Cake Loaf with Cream Cheese Icing
    Delicious Butter Pecan Cake Loaf with Cream Cheese Icing Recipe
  • Coffee And Walnut Loaf
    Irresistible Coffee And Walnut Loaf for Cozy Afternoons
  • Cottage Cheese Peanut Butter Smoothie
    Creamy Cottage Cheese Peanut Butter Smoothie Bliss
  • Caribbean-Style Plantain Curry
    Delicious Caribbean-Style Plantain Curry Ready in 40 Minutes

Seasonal

  • Tinga de Pollo
    Delicious Tinga de Pollo: A Flavorful Homemade Delight
  • Strawberry Topped Cheesecake
    Delicious Strawberry Topped Cheesecake to Impress Friends
  • Honey-Glazed Shallots with Crispy Bacon
    Sweet and Savory Honey-Glazed Shallots with Crispy Bacon Delight
  • Strawberry Topped Cheesecake Dessert
    Decadent Strawberry Topped Cheesecake Dessert to Savor

Footer

Copyright © 2025 SeasonBite Privacy Policy Terms & Conditions Disclaimer